Hi,TechNetters,

We are useing 4 mil double treatment thin core from AlliedSignal to build 
PCMCIA innerlayers. We find a great difficulty in instpection innerlayers with 
AOI (Insight/2020 Gerber).The machine just cann't see the deference between
the circuit and background.

To get a threshold value, we try defferent settings,

        *Changing high-inspection lamp
        *Adjusting the image threshlod sliders
        *Adding filters either on specular side or diffuse side, even on both 
         sides.(600nm spectral filters)

The result is negetive.

I'm appreciate if anyone with thin core AOI instpetion experience can provide 
an answer.
